首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 31 毫秒
1.
所谓OLE(ObjectLinkingandEmbedding),可以用一句话来概括,那就是Windows平台下应用程序之间数据共享的技术,或者说是Windows应用程序之间相互交换数据的技术。Windows下有3种程序之间相互交换数据的方法:剪贴板Clipboard、动态数据交换DDE和OLE。剪贴板是最简单的一种数据共享方法,DDE是几年前Windows程序之间交换数据的常用的方法,而OLE则是Windows平台下程序间数据共享的最新技术。自从Microsoft支持OLE技术以后,就很少有人再使用DDE了。从剪贴板谈起那么什么是应用程序之间数据共事呢?让我们从Windows的剪贴板(…  相似文献   

2.
LabVIEW中DDE不同通信方式的比较分析   总被引:2,自引:0,他引:2  
DDE(动态数据交换)是Windows环境提供的一种基于消息的进程间通信技术协议。Windows环境下的多种软件系统及软件开发平台,如VB,VC,Excel,Foxpro,PB,Developer/2000等都提供了DDE功能。文中对DDE通信的几种不同方式做了简单的比较和分析,并给出了示例程序。  相似文献   

3.
DDE (动态数据交换)是Windows环境提供的一种基于消息的进程间通信技术协议.Windows环境下的多种软件系统及软件开发平台,如VB, VC, Excel, Foxpro, PB, Developer/2000等都提供了DDE功能.文中对DDE通信的几种不同方式做了简单的比较和分析,并给出了示例程序.  相似文献   

4.
梁庚  白焰  李文 《计算机应用》2003,23(Z2):224-226
DDE是Windows所制定的程序间通信的一种常用的协议.DDE技术的应用有许多优点,有着广泛的应用领域.文中详细阐述了Windows DDE事务管理库DDEML的组成及工作原理,并结合工程,实际详细给出了应用DDEML开发设计DDE服务器和客户端应用程序的方法.  相似文献   

5.
动态数据交换(DDE)是Windows所制定的程序间通讯协议,是应用程序间进行数据交换的一种方法,允许应用程序间共享数据,从而可为用户提供更为集中的运算环境。VFP系统是一个功能强大的关系型数据库管理系统,它对动态数据交换(DDE)的支持使得它能够作为DDE的服  相似文献   

6.
动态数据交换(Dynamic Data Exchange,简称DDE)和对象连接与嵌入(Object Linking Embedding,简称OLE)是Windows为运行在其上的应用程序之间的信息共享所提供的两种方法。许多基于Windows的应用程序都在设法使其支持这两种方法。Visual BASIC for Windows 2.0版本(以下简称VB)就完全支持这两种方法。 一、动态数据交换 支持动态数据交换(DDE)的两个应用程序之间可通过所谓的DDE对话(也称为DDE连接)来自动地交换数据。在对话中,提出对话的一方称为目的程序(在VB1.0中称为客户),做出反应的一方称为源程序(在VB1.0中称为服务者)。目的程序是数据的接收方,源程序是数据的供给方。在VB中,文  相似文献   

7.
莫梓超 《电脑》1995,(9):11-13
一、DDE简介在Windows环境下,程序间进行数据交换有几种方法:剪贴板、临时文件、动态数据交换(DDE)、对象链接(OLE)、动态链接库(DLL)等,我们要讨论的是动态数据交换,即DDE技术.在软件领域,越来越多的Windows软件开始支持DDE技术,以享受Windows提供的多任务运行机制,同时减少重复编程,也丰富了程序员的可利用资源.遗憾的是,国内的软件开发很少使用DDE技术,  相似文献   

8.
一个商品化的软件都提供安装程序,用户只需要运行程序SETUP.EXE或INSTALL.EXE,确认版权信息、输入产品序列号及选择不同的安装方式,即可按提示完成软件的安装。 一、DDE接口 为了方便用户使用,还必须创建程序文件夹和快捷键。Windows是利用Program Manager的动态数据交换DDE接口来创建程序文件夹和快捷键的。为了帮助读者理解DDE的机制,我们首先要简单的介绍一下DDE的概念。 动态数据交换是Windows应用程序在运行时数据交换的一种技术,它是由一组DDE协议构成,并由DDEML动态库所支持。在一次DDE动态交互过程中,进行交互的一方称为客户方,另一方称为服务器方,而且一次DDE交互总是从客户端发起,由服务器提供各种数据服务。每个服务器有唯一的一个名  相似文献   

9.
LabVIEW与Excel的通信方法   总被引:1,自引:0,他引:1  
在虚拟仪器开发过程中,需要将一些多路采集数据存储在Excel表格中。LabVIEW是一种方便灵活的虚拟仪器开发环境,而LabVIEW中的DDE是Windows操作系统中的一种基于消息的协议。利用LabVIEW的DDE功能可以很好地实现LabVIEW与Excel的数据通信。通过具体例子叙述了LabVIEW的DDE功能,这种功能使得LabVIEW与Excel的数据交换方便怏捷,实现方法简单明了,实践表明DDE是增强LabVIEW整体功能的一条有效途径。  相似文献   

10.
VB(VisualBasicforWindowi)数据交换支持动态数据交换(DDE),动态连接库(DLL)和对象嵌入(OLE)等。这些特色使得VB的应用软件可以从其它基于Windows的应用程序获得数据、更新数据。本文简要介绍VisualBasic应用程序间动态数据交换的实现方法。1VB中DDE的链接方式动态数据交换(DDE):是在当前Windows应用程序间,为通过激活的链接来交换数据而建立的一种协议。通常把这种数据交换的过程称为对话。DDE链接可以在设计程序时建立,也可以在运行程序时建立。链接方式(LinkMode)对源程序和目的程序有不同的含义。对于源…  相似文献   

11.
一、前言 在Windows 3.1 SDK为应用程序开发提供的诸多手段中,用DDE实现的并发程序之间数据交换功能对应用程序多任务处理有着普遍的针对性和实用性。尤其是DDE管理库支持的一组API函数使一般编程人员在程序中利用DDE技术成为现实。本文给出针对一个典型的数据服务问题利用DDEML API编制的DDE服务器程序,并重点论述DDE会话和事务在服务器中的处理过程。同时本程序可与Microsoft在SDK中给出的一个客户示范程序构成一个DDE的实际运行和调试环境,这些将使用户对DDE在服务器程序中的实现方法和过程有一个了解。  相似文献   

12.
罗粮  石锐  英振华  沈潇 《计算机工程与设计》2005,26(12):3386-3388,3412
介绍了组态软件对外集成的几种方式,以及Windows提供的支持这几种方式的DDE、OPC、ActiveX自动化等几种标准,通过这几种方式,可以实现程序间数据交换,方便对外集成,并在实际工程中应用涉及到的主要技术,取得了良好的效果。  相似文献   

13.
动态数据交换(Dynamic Data Exhange,DDE)是由Windows提供的一种强大的功能,就是在应用程序之间能够相互交换数据。此功能不仅广泛用于单机,而且可用于网络。后者称为“网络DDE”。在实时监控系统的开发和应用中,DDE功能起着非常重要的作用。 DDE可以使你的的应用程序自动地接收其它应用程序传来的数据,传送端的数据一旦有任何变动,接收端都可以自动更新。反之,你的应用程序也可以传送  相似文献   

14.
介绍了组态软件InTouch与MATLAB集成的几种方式,以及Windows提供的支持这几种方式的DDE、OLE自动化、Ac-tiveX控件等标准.通过这几种方式,可以实现程序之间数据交换,方便对外集成,扩展功能.  相似文献   

15.
DDE与beE是Windows3.1比较重要的功能,它们可在Windows应用系统中实现数据的共享,达到快速传送数据的目的。本文深入剖析DDE与OI。E,并给出应用实例。Windows3.l最重要的特点之一就是在应用程序之间可共享数据,其中动态数据交换(DDE)和对象链接与嵌入(of。E)等方法就是较好的例子。动态数据交换DDE剪贴板(Clipb(。ard)是Window。操作系统巾进行数据交换的常用手段之一,但其缺点就是一次只能保存一项内容。另外,每次发送数据都需要用户去干涉。而DDE允许动态传送数据而不需用户干涉。回,DDE的特点DDE是动态数据…  相似文献   

16.
利用DDE技术实现KingView与VC程序的监控数据通讯   总被引:2,自引:2,他引:0  
本文介绍了Windows环境下DDE(动态数据交换)技术原理,以及组态软件KingView与开发工具VC对DDE技术的支持,说明了KingView应用与VC应用程序之间利用DDE进行监控数据通信实现方法。  相似文献   

17.
中文WINDOWS3.1最重要的特点之一就是在应用程序之间可共享数据,其中动态数据交换(DDE)和对象链接与嵌入(OLE)等方法就是较好的例子。下面对使用DDE、OLE的难点作些分析,并给出实例说明。一、动态数据交换DDE剪贴板(CliPbeard)是Windows中进行数据交换的常用手段之一,但其缺点就是一次只能保存一项内容。另外,每次发送数据都需要用户去干涉。DDE允许动态传送数据而不需要干涉。1.DDE的特点DDE就是一种允许Windows应用程序共享数据或相互之间发送消息的消息系统。作为DDE如何运行的简单例子,考虑将字处理软件WO…  相似文献   

18.
基于Windows DDE的客户/服务器应用开发   总被引:4,自引:0,他引:4  
Windows应用程序进程间客户/服务器模式的通信实现,是软件工程设计中经常涉及的一个重要问题。阐述了Windows应用程序进程间DDE通信的基本原理,由此给出了设计开发DDE客户/服务器应用的两种方案,并论述了两种方案各自的优点及不足之处。结合工程实际,详细给出了应用Windows DDE API方案开发设计DDE服务器和客户端应用程序的方法。实践表明,应用Windows DDE技术设计客户/服务器应用具有开发周期短、实用性强的优点。  相似文献   

19.
介绍了DDE的工作原理,分析了基于消息和基于DDEML的两种DDE工作方式的异同,突出了DDEML的优点,即提供了一系列DDEMLAPI函数,使用户不必了解DDE通信的细节,减轻了编程的难度和工作量。还阐述了服务、主题、项目等基本概念,并分析DDE的会话过程,对DDEMLAPI函数和回调函数的编程作了介绍。最后给出了利用DDE技术,在Windows环境下实时访问FoxPro数据库中数据的实例程序。  相似文献   

20.
在工作组上用Visual Basic实现DDE   总被引:1,自引:0,他引:1  
DDE(Dynamic Data Exchange)是Windows提供的一种重要功能。通过DDE,服务器应用程序与客户应用程序建立连接通道,相互交换数据。当在Windows 3.0或Windows 3.1上使用DDE时,服务器应用程序与客户应用程序必须在同一台计算机上。 工作组Windows for Workgroup 3.11(简称WFW)是Microsoft Windows 3.1的增强版本,除了Windows 3.1的标准特性和成份外,WFW还通过网络硬件连接提供了方便的网络存取机制。利用这种存取机制,一个工作组可以在不同的层次上,共享磁盘驱动器(硬盘和目录)和连接在工作组中的任意一台计算机上的打印机。WFW还提供了网络DDE机制,即通  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号